It is with profound sadness that the family of Garth David Melle announces his passing on March 29, 2025, at the age of 68. Born on October 19, 1956, in Radville, Saskatchewan, Garth lived a life defined by integrity, kindness, and an unwavering sense of fairness.
Garth grew up in Minton, Saskatchewan, where he developed a strong work ethic, a love for the outdoors, and an interest in mechanics. Even in his early years, he was known for being intelligent, straightforward, and fiercely independent. He had a natural ability to connect with people, a trait that would serve him well throughout his personal and professional life.
In 1990, Garth married the love of his life, Lavonne Melle, and together they built a life filled with adventure, laughter, and countless cherished memories. Their 34 years of marriage were marked by deep companionship, travel, and an ever-growing circle of friends and family.
Garth had many passions, including fishing, biking, building vehicles, music, and enjoying a cold beer— and, as he would freely admit, smoking too. He was a man who valued honesty, intelligence, and fairness, and he carried these traits into every aspect of his life. He never complained, facing every challenge with resilience and a positive attitude.
Garth’s career in the Credit Union system began in the 1980s, where he managed several small-town Credit Unions. In the 1990s, he transitioned to SaskCentral, where he played a pivotal role in financial services challenges. Later, he joined the Credit Union Deposit Guarantee Corporation, where he served in various leadership positions before retiring in 2017 as CEO.
Garth was highly respected not only within Saskatchewan’s Credit Union system but also on a national level. His contributions helped shape financial regulations, and his leadership left a lasting impact on the industry.

One of Garth’s final wishes was to see a PET scan machine in the Regina–Moose Jaw area. The only available PET scan in Saskatchewan is in Saskatoon, and Garth, like many others, was too ill to make the trip. In his honor, a fundraising initiative will be launched to help bring this critical cancer-detection technology closer to home. Where to donate will be shared at a later date.
